Census: 1860, Western District, Marion County, Alabama, Pikeville Post Office, #585, page 109, dwelling house 777, family number 705, was enumerated by Jaspher Clark on July 16, 1860 D. H. Hollis, (this is David H. Hollis), age 30, place of birth: Alabama, occupation: Farmer, value of real estate: $250.00, value of personal estate: $4,190.00 Francis Hollis, age 20, place of birth, South Carolina John Hollis, age 1, place of birth, Alabama Derrill Hollis, age 1, place of birth, Alabama
Census: 1870, Sanford County, Alabama, Vernon/Moscow Post Office was enumerated by M. W. Martin?, on July 12, 1870, 374A, page 9. Sampson Loller, age 24, place of birth: Tennessee, occupation: Farmer, value of real estate: $?00, value of personal property: $400.00 Francis Loller, age 27, place of birth: South Carolina Loller, Inez, daughter, female, age 7 months, place of birth: Alabama Loller, Irene, daughter, female, age 7 months, place of birth: Alabama (enumerator wrote twins). John R. Hollis, age 10, place of birth: Alabama D. U. Hollis, age 10, place of birth: Alabama (enumerator wrote twins). Susan Hollis, age 8, place of birth: Alabama Mary Hollis, age 6, place of birth: Alabama
Francis had two sets of twins. John R. Hollis and D. U. Hollis are the son's of David H. and Francis Hollis. Also, Susan Hollis and Mary Hollis are the daughters of David H. and Francis Hollis. Twin girls, Irene & Inez were born about 1870, and are the children of Sampson and Francis Loller, or Lollar.
1880 Census - Lamar County, Alabama, Vol II, sheet no 15, line #33, #587-B, Beat no 8, June 14, 1880 Lollar, Samson, age 33, place of birth: Tennessee, Occupation: Farmer Lollar, Francis A., age 35, wife, place of birth: South Carolina, Occupation: Keeping house Lollar, Inez (twin), age 10, daughter, place of birth: Alabama Lollar, Irene (twin), age 10, daughter, place of birth: Alabama Lollar, Saint Elmo, age 8, son, place of birth: Alabama Lollar, Ida, age 6, daughter, place of birth: Alabama Lollar, Nuney, age 4, son, place of birth: Alabama Hollis, John, age 21, step son, place of birth: Alabama Hollis, Dearel, age 21, step son, place of birth: Alabama Hollis, Susan, age 19, step daughter, place of birth: Alabama Hollis, Mary, age 17, step daughter, place of birth: Alabama
Marriage: Fanny Hollis to ? Lollar, Sept 23, 1869, by: T. Morton, Judge of Probate. Reference: Lamar County, Alabama. AlGenWeb: 1867 - 1871 Marriage Jones and Sanford County, Alabama Marriages.
(Francis Lollar or Loller is also Francis A. Hollis, whose first spouse was David H. Hollis). Francis had two sets of twins. John R. Hollis and D. U. Hollis are the son's of David H. Hollis. The 7 month old twins - Inez and Irene are the children of Sampson and Francis A. Lollar or Loller. John R. Hollis, D. U. Hollis, Susan Hollis & Mary Hollis are the children of David H. and Francis A. Hollis.
p. 31 Bond: D.W. Hollis: Danniel W. Hollis, Derule Hollis are held and firmly bound...Daniel Hollis was duly appointed guardian on the 21 day of May 1869,in the estate of Daniel Hollis Jr., John, Susan and Mary Hollis. 26 May 1869. Signed Danil W. Hollis, D. U. Hollis, and Allen Jordan.
Daniel William Hollis is the Uncle of Derrell, John, Susan & Mary Hollis. He is appointed guardian of them. Daniel William Hollis is the brother of David H. Hollis, deceased and the father of the children. p.32 Dan W. Hollis moves upon the court to appoint him as guardian of the above named minors (Derrell Hollis, John Hollis, Susan Hollis, Mary Hollis). Said minors are under the age of 14, and have an estate in common in Pickens Co., AL to collect out of the estate of their great grandfather, Daniel Godwin of the __of two hundred and fifty dollars and not more and having given bond and security of the said amt in double the value of the collected or aforesaid...Said Hollis be appointed the said guardianship...May 26, 1860*.
